Italy 2-0 Greece: Chelsea’s Jorginho scores as Italy secure Euro 2020 spot

Italy secured their place at next year’s Euro 2020 finals by beating Greece 2-0 in Rome.

After a goalless first half, Chelsea midfielder Jorginho opened the scoring from the penalty spot after Andreas Bouchalakis’ handball.

Substitute Federico Bernardeschi added a late second with a dipping effort from distance.

The win means Italy top Group J with 21 points, an unassailable 11 points clear of third-placed Armenia.

Greece needed to win to keep their own qualification hopes alive but they rarely threatened.

Italy had been booed off at half-time after failing to manage a single shot on target but they were much improved after the break, with Jorginho’s opener visibly relaxing his team-mates.
